The fascia is the long, straight board that runs along the lower edge of your roof. It’s the part that your gutters are attached to. The soffit is the surface underneath the roof overhang, and it's usually vented to help air flow into your attic space. Together, fascia and soffits form a boundary between your roof and the outside elements. The fascia helps hold up the bottom row of shingles and keeps water from blowing back under your roof’s edge. It also supports the weight of your gutters. The soffit lets air move through your attic and release moisture. When either of these parts starts to fail, you’ll see signs. The paint may bubble. You might notice moisture damage, mold, or warped wood. Small animals might find their way into your attic. Your attic space builds up heat and moisture. Without a way to vent it out, your insulation can get damp, your roof deck can warp, and shingles can start to fail prematurely. Most soffits include small vents that allow fresh air to enter at the roof’s edge. The air moves up through the attic and exits at the top through ridge or gable vents. It’s a cycle that keeps the attic dry and temperature-balanced. When the soffit is blocked, damaged, or poorly designed, the entire system can go out of balance. Moisture stays trapped. Wood begins to swell or decay. Mold can grow. Ice dams can form in the winter. In many cases, small sections can be patched or replaced to restore airflow without tearing everything out. Usually, it's just a small vent screen that’s rusted through or a spot where a bird pecked through old wood. These can all be handled quickly and professionally.

A lot of fascia repair jobs start with a failing gutter. If the gutter clogs or leaks, instead of moving water away from the house, it spills over or behind. Water ends up saturating the fascia board behind it, and the wood softens, warps, and finally starts to rot. Once rot sets in, the gutter has nothing solid to anchor into. Some homeowners think they need a brand new gutter system, but usually, the real fix starts with fascia repair in Hendersonville. Replacing a small section of rotted wood and resealing the seam can give your gutter a firm hold again. Then, you can re-secure it and avoid further water damage. It’s worth inspecting your gutters after every big storm, too. If you see sagging, leaking, or debris buildup, take action early. Catching it early can prevent a full fascia replacement.
Roof replacements are expensive. Most homeowners want to avoid them as long as possible. Thankfully, keeping your fascia and soffits in good shape can go a long way toward preserving your roof. If they’re working as intended, they block out wind, water, and wildlife. They support your gutters, ventilate your attic, and keep everything in balance. When they fail, the damage spreads, first to the decking, then to the insulation, and then to the interior ceilings. The smart way forward is to handle issues when they’re still small. A trusted handyman can take care of minor fascia repair or soffit repair in an afternoon, especially when only a small portion is affected. In more serious cases, like when the damage has spread several feet, partial fascia replacement or soffit replacement may be necessary. Still, that’s a far cry from a full tear-off. For many homes, these smaller jobs buy you years of extra life from your existing roofing materials.
